Statute of Limitations

Despite asbestos being banned in the 1970s many suffer from mesothelioma and asbestos-related diseases and other asbestos-related diseases due to exposure that was negligent. Asbestos victims, and their families, should receive compensation from those who cause this deadly disease. A knowledgeable New York mesothelioma attorney can assist victims and their loved ones receive the compensation they are due.

New York has laws that regulate the statute of limitations. These laws are intended to ensure that lawsuits filed within a certain time frame are enforceable. State-specific statutes of limitations vary however, they all establish a standard as to the time frame a victim must have to file a lawsuit following an injury was caused.

In general, statutes are implemented to fulfill practical needs - to ensure timely proceedings as well as to assist witnesses and plaintiffs remember important facts, and to safeguard defendants against the loss of important evidence. Because of the nature of asbestos and its resiliency, asbestos attorney lawsuits need to be considered with particular care in terms of statutes of limitations.

It could take a long time for asbestos-related illnesses to manifest in the first place, which can delay the statute of limitations for victims. It can be challenging for some plaintiffs due the delay in filing a suit within the proper timeframe. However, a skilled attorney can guide victims through the process.

The statute of limitations for asbestos lawsuits can differ based on the location the victim lived and when they were diagnosed, and the amount of asbestos exposure they experienced. A mesothelioma lawyer is able to review all the relevant data and determine the best state to file a claim in.

How to File a Claim

A lawsuit is a legal procedure by which victims, or family members, name the company or person they believe to be accountable for asbestos exposure. They then request them to pay a sum of money. After a lawsuit has been filed, defendants have the option to either negotiate a settlement with the plaintiff or refute the claim.

After a lawyer has gathered sufficient evidence, they will make a complaint to the appropriate court on your behalf. The complaint will contain the facts of your case and lists the manufacturers of asbestos products that you believe are accountable. When the complaint is filed, they will forward a copy to the manufacturer and they will be given the chance to respond.

You may be entitled to compensation for any harms and losses you've suffered as a result of your diagnosis. This could include the monetary value of your pain and suffering and medical expenses, as well as lost wages, loss of consortium (loss of companionship) and other out-of-pocket expenses. Often, victims are also entitled to punitive damages to punish the defendants and prevent similar conduct in the future.

Representation in Court

Asbestos was an everyday material in different industries. Workers worked side-by-side with it for a long time, unaware of the dangers it could pose to their health. Many of these workers later developed asbestos-related diseases, including mesothelioma. Fortunately, victims and their families are able to seek compensation from the companies who put profit ahead of safety by filing a lawsuit against asbestos.

An experienced asbestos lawyer will conduct a thorough investigation prior to submitting your case. This includes identifying the sources of exposure and anticipating defense strategies of the parties responsible. Often, a victim's asbestos-related diseases were caused by multiple kinds of exposure. For instance, pipefitters that worked at a power station could have been exposed both nuclear and coal-fired energy. These workers were exposed to asbestos and insulation used to wrap high-heat machinery, such as generators, boilers, and pipes.

After your lawyer has determined that you are eligible to bring a lawsuit, they will begin gathering medical evidence and expert testimony to back your claims. This includes obtaining copies of your medical records as well as hiring medical experts to testify in depositions and during trial. Expert testimony is crucial to establish causation and the legal basis of your claim.
